The Senior Communications Officer reports into the Head of Marketing and Strategic Communications and is responsible for leading St Giles Hospice's communications in line with the overall organisational strategy. They will line manage the External Communications Coordinator and the Social Media and Digital Content Coordinator.

The Senior Communications Officer has responsibility for St Giles' internal and external communications. The role encompasses all functions across the hospice, including clinical services and income generation, and will focus on raising awareness and engagement, both locally and nationally, to:

Increase visibility and awareness of hospice services

Enhance stakeholder engagement

Strengthen media relationships for timely and accurate coverage

Amplify the hospice's voice on critical issues affecting the sector

Support income generation efforts

Working with the External Communications Coordinator, the Senior Communications Officer will lead on the creation and development of compelling and accessible external communications for a range of audiences, build trust in and commitment to St Giles Hospice and ensure St Giles' connects with its stakeholders. Senior Communications Officer will lead on the internal communications programme for both volunteers and staff at St Giles working closely with departments across the organisation, in particular the People and Organisational Development team, to plan and coordinate communications needs.

The Senior Communications Officer will work closely with, and deputise for the Senior Marketing Officer, to ensure a collaborative approach to the organisation's marketing and communications activity.
